Line a baking sheet with waxed paper.
2
In a medium saucepan, melt the chocolate and shortening over low heat for 1 to 2 minutes, stirring just until the chocolate melts and the mixture is smooth. Allow to cool slightly so that the chocolate is not hot enough to pop a balloon, but is still pourable.
3
Inflate the balloons to about the size of an orange; tie knots to seal.
4
Starting halfway from the knotted end, spoon the chocolate over the outside of the balloons, completely covering the outside bottom half of each. Allow the excess chocolate to drip off the bottom of the balloons and place them on the lined baking sheet.
5
Chill for 25 to 30 minutes, until the chocolate is firm. Carefully pop the balloons and remove them from the chocolate cups. Chill until ready to serve.
